In an influential essay titled “Atomism”, Charles Taylor objected to the liberal view that “men are self-sufficient outside of society”. (Taylor 1985, 2000) Instead, Taylor defends the Aristotelian view that “Man is a social animal, indeed a political animal, because he is not self-sufficient alone, and in an important sense is not self-sufficient outside a polis” (Taylor 1985, 190).
